UV print technology or Ultra Violet printing uses especially manufactured UV healing inks which enable us to publish onto a large range of roll and sheet materials. The ink consists of small polymers, monomers (light-weight particles that fuse to develop polymers) and initiators. When subjected to UV light the initiators (a stimulant) start a rapid domino effect which creates polymerisation of the ink which drys and hardens almost instantaneously.

Sheet lamination can be split right into 2 different technologies, laminated item manufacturing (LOM) and ultrasonic additive production (UAM). LOM makes use of alternating layers of material and glue to produce things with visual and visual appeal, while UAM signs up with slim sheets of metal by means of ultrasonic welding. UAM is a reduced temperature, low power procedure that can be made use of with aluminium, stainless steel and titanium.
